About

Why this artist matters now

Denis Brihat was a French photographer whose black-and-white work explored the formal and tactile qualities of natural objects and landscapes. Active from the 1950s onward, he developed a distinctive approach centered on close observation of texture, light, and botanical forms. His practice emerged within the postwar European photography tradition, prioritizing subtle gradations of tone and the materiality of the photographic print itself.
